Homeschooled team wins first district title

ERIC MUSKATEVC
Published November 7, 2003

ST. PETERSBURG - Michael Bauer has his twin brother, Christopher, by six minutes and two goals.

He scored twice in the first half before the rain to give Pinellas Christian Homeschool a 2-1 victory against Canterbury in the district final at Puryear Park on Thursday.

Fourteen minutes into the Patriots' first district final in their three years, Bauer gave them a 1-0 lead. Four minutes later, he made it 2-0.

Canterbury got its only goal from Robert Donaldson with 13 minutes left in the first half. It lost for the fourth time this season to Pinellas Christian.
